What will be the global aniline derivative market size during the projected period (2025-2034)?
The global aniline derivative market size was worth around USD 22.19 billion in 2024 and is predicted to grow to around USD 30.92 billion by 2034, with a compound annual growth rate (CAGR) of roughly 3.06% between 2025 and 2034.
Aniline derivatives are produced by modifying aniline, which is a chemical compound consisting of a benzene ring. According to industry analysis, aniline derivatives have wide applications across multiple industries, including pharmaceuticals, manufacturing dyes, agrochemicals, polymers, and other materials. Aniline derivatives are produced by substituting one or more hydrogen atoms from the amino group present in aniline. The modifications include hydroxyl, halogen, nitro, or methyl groups. Changing the chemical composition of aniline subsequently results in changes in molecular properties such as solubility, reactivity, color, and texture. During the forecast period, demand for aniline derivatives is expected to continue growing, driven by several favorable factors. For instance, growing end-user demand for fertilizers and other agrochemicals will drive industry demand in the coming years.
Additionally, the rising prevalence of medical conditions is expected to encourage greater use of aniline derivatives in drug research & development. The industry growth trends may be affected by regulatory concerns affecting market expansion, in addition to growing concerns over health risks associated with the chemical compounds.
Growth Drivers
How will growing applications in the textile sector fuel growth in the aniline derivative market?
The global aniline derivative market is expected to grow due to the rising demand for the compounds in the textile industry. Aniline derivatives are extensively used in producing dyes and pigments. According to industry research, popular artificial or synthetic dyes such as aniline blue, indigo, and azo dyes are produced using aniline derivatives. They are further applied in the thriving textile sector. The rising global population, along with changing consumer lifestyles and evolving fashion trends worldwide, has significantly influenced demand in the textile industry.
In addition, the rapid expansion of fast and ultra-fast fashion, along with the proliferation of the e-commerce industry, is expected to work in favor of aniline derivatives in the coming years. Dyes made using aniline are preferred among fashion brands because they are highly durable and versatile. In addition, aniline dyes bond to a wide range of fabrics such as cotton and polyester. The surging demand for affordable and luxury fashion will emerge as an influential factor for aniline derivative manufacturers during the projection period.
Increasing production of agrochemicals to facilitate improved revenue for aniline derivatives
Aniline derivatives are critical ingredients used in the production of agrochemicals such as pesticides, fungicides, and herbicides. Modern farming techniques rely heavily on agrochemicals to enhance crop yield and improve overall produce quality. As per industry research, aniline derivatives, when used as agrochemicals, are highly effective in delivering desired results in low quantities as well.
On the other hand, growing cases of crop damage caused by insects or fungal infestations further amplify the use of critical aniline derivatives, such as phenylamine fungicides. Growing food demand worldwide and the accelerating use of highly effective agrochemicals will work in favor of the global aniline derivative market during the forecast period.
Restraints
Which safety concerns create growth barriers in the aniline derivative market?
The global aniline derivative industry is expected to be limited due to the rising safety concerns associated with the compounds. Industry research suggests that exposure to aniline derivatives can be harmful to the ecosystem and living organisms. For instance, certain derivatives are toxic to humans, causing shortness of breath, dizziness, and oxygen deprivation.
Furthermore, they also lead to water pollution and affect marine ecosystems. Regulatory bodies such as the Environmental Protection Agency (EPA) and Occupational Safety and Health Administration (OSHA) have classified aniline derivatives as hazardous, thus limiting market expansion trends.
Opportunities
Accelerating the use of aniline derivatives in the pharmaceutical industry to generate growth opportunities
The global aniline derivative market is expected to generate growth opportunities due to the rising use of the compound in the pharmaceutical sector. Aniline derivatives are used for the production of popular analgesics such as paracetamol and acetanilide. Analgesics are widely used medicinal drugs that help relieve pain by blocking pain signals or making changes to pain perception. The rising prevalence of pain-causing medical conditions has amplified demand for analgesics, subsequently driving revenue for aniline derivatives. Analgesics are used after surgical interventions or an injury.
Furthermore, they are also helpful in managing pain caused by arthritis or cancer. In the last few years, healthcare expenditure worldwide has grown at an unprecedented rate. Factors such as a growing geriatric population, rising cases of cancer, and accidents have worked in tandem to influence demand for aniline derivatives. The global expansion of the healthcare sector will open new avenues for industry growth during the projection period.
Challenges
Why are supply chain disruptions considered major challenges in the aniline derivative market?
The global aniline derivative industry is expected to be challenged by severe supply chain disruptions. Global production and supply of aniline derivatives depend on accessibility to petrochemicals. However, evolving market dynamics and changing geopolitical trade relationships are likely to affect production and prices associated with aniline derivatives.

The global aniline derivative market is segmented based on application, end-user application, and region.
Based on application, the global market is segmented into rubber processing, dyes & pigments, drug production, agrochemicals, polyurethane, explosives, varnishes, and others. In 2024, the highest growth was listed in the dyes & pigments segment. The growing use of textile dyes worldwide has fueled segmental demand. In addition, the rapid global expansion of the textile industry and the explosion of the fashion e-commerce sector will further facilitate segmental growth in the coming years.
Based on end-use application, the global market is segmented into rubber, textile, pharmaceutical, agriculture, plastic, paints & inks, and others. In 2024, the textile applications of aniline derivatives were the most dominant influencers. Rising world population, increasing demand for fast-fashion, affordable clothing items, and growing investments in luxury fashion will promote the segmental growth rate during the projection period.
Why will Asia-Pacific continue to dominate the aniline derivative market during the forecast period?
The global aniline derivative market is expected to be dominated by Asia-Pacific during the projection period. The region is expected to deliver a CAGR of more than 4.59% during the projection period. In 2024, the Asia-Pacific region accounted for over 53% of the global revenue, with China and India leading the regional market. Growth in the Asia-Pacific is driven by the development of chemical manufacturing infrastructure. China is the world’s largest supplier of essential chemicals serving global clients.
In addition, the Asia-Pacific has a high demand for aniline derivatives with applications across major industries. The regional textile sector is one of the largest consumers of aniline derivatives, as China continues to invest in dominating the global fast-fashion landscape.
North America is projected to emerge as the second-highest revenue generator in the aniline derivative industry. It is expected to grow at a CAGR of more than 3.71% during the forecast period. The North American market will be led by the higher use of aniline derivatives in the regional pharmaceutical industry.
Furthermore, the North American market is also heavily influenced by the presence of standard policies regulating the production and safe use of aniline derivatives. In addition, the compounds have excellent scope for expansion in the region’s agricultural sector, as North America is shifting toward encouraging regional crop production and reducing reliance on other countries for crop imports.

Rising production of polyurethane
A major trend observed in the aniline derivative industry is the growing production of polyurethane. Aniline derivatives are used as essential feed for producing polyurethane, which has applications in the construction and automotive sectors. These applications may offer new growth prospects to the industry players.
Sustainable production practices
As the world moves toward sustainability, aniline derivative producers are actively seeking technologies that encourage green manufacturing of the compounds. These solutions include ensuring catalyst optimization and improvement of the atom economy, among other methods.
